Bicycle Friendly Community Program - Pedaling Toward Platinum

The Tucson/Eastern Pima County Region is designated a Gold Level Bicycle Friendly Community by the League of American Bicyclists (LAB). The LAB is one of the largest and most respected bicycle advocacy organizations in the country.

The award reflects the exceptional level of cooperation among the nine regional jurisdictions, and acknowledges the depth and breadth of programs, policies, facilities and outreach that make the Tucson-Pima Eastern Region the premier bicycle friendly region in the country. 

While we are proud of the gold designation, the region strives for platinum, the highest rating given. PAG coordinates the Platinum Challenge Task Force, a group of citizens, jurisdiction staff, law enforcement and interest group representatives that work together to identify improvements needed in order to become a platinum-level community, encourage the region to implement them and develop the regional application to submit to the League of American Bicyclists.

History

2012 – PAG will submit an application in February for Platinum status on behalf of the region. 
2008 – PAG submitted another regional application and the region was re-designated a Gold-rated community. To view the 2008 application, click on the link above. 
2006 – PAG submitted an application on behalf of the region and received a Gold designation.
2004 – The City of Tucson submitted an Bicycle Friendly Community application and was designated a silver community.
